Is vertical blinds outdated?

Vertical blinds are not necessarily outdated—they can still be both stylish and functional. However, many people have begun to opt for other window treatments that offer more creative solutions. While vertical blinds can provide a modern and clean look, they can be overly utilitarian and less visually appealing than other options.

Curtains, shutters, honeycomb shades, and other window treatments offer more design versatility as well as better insulation, comfort, and light control. They can also add warmth and character to any room.

Ultimately, whether vertical blinds are outdated or not is up to personal preference, but there are more stylish and functional options available to homeowners.

Can vertical blind headrail be cut to size?

Yes, vertical blind headrails can typically be cut to size. The headrail is the track or rod at the top of a window fitted with vertical blinds that houses and supports the individual vanes that make up the window covering.

Depending on the style of blinds, the headrail can be made of either aluminum or PVC plastic, and so it can usually be somewhat easily cut with a hacksaw. It is important to cut the headrail carefully and accurately to ensure a proper fit, as any inaccuracies in the cut may prevent the vanes from sliding properly and from sitting flush against the window.

If you are at all unsure about how to properly make the cut, it is best to speak with a professional and have them do the job for you.
